Questions to ask on a tour

Chosen for this facility's inspection history and profile — bring them along on your visit.

  1. This facility has health or sanitation findings on its state record - ask about their current cleaning, diapering, and handwashing procedures
  2. This facility has staffing or training findings on its state record - ask about background checks, required training completion, and staff turnover
  3. Ask how they keep enrollment, immunization, and emergency-contact records current - their state findings include documentation lapses
  4. This is a large program - ask how children are grouped, how ratios are kept in each room, and how staff cover breaks

2026

  1. Medium-High riskStandard 234/6/2026

    23. (23-02)

    The facility did not have a current and approved annual fire safety inspection by the local fire authority. CCF Handbook, Section 3.8.2, A (Section 2.1 - Health and Safety, Page 3) Physical Environment [SR] Comments: LS observed the facility did not have a current and approved annual fire safety inspection by the local fire authority. CCF Handbook, Section 3.8.2, A (Section 2.1 - Health and Safety, Page 3) LS observed fire inspection expired 3/18/26. Provider will need to send LS inspection report after completion.
